The New Mexico Department of Transportation (NMDOT) is currently developing the I-40 Drainage Improvement and Bridge Replacement Project, which will construct drainage improvements and bridge replacements on I-40 and NM-118 at Mile Post 29.7 south of Church Rock, east of NM-566.
The purpose of this meeting is to share project details and discuss potential temporary road closures and detours during construction. There will also be an opportunity to ask questions and provide comments.
